Recycled lamp lights things up
And here's another one from the fantastic [re]design show that took place last month. It's a spiffing earthy-looking lamp made from recycled cardboard that - according to designer G|O|E - will take a good battering if you're inclined to knocking your lamps around. There's a concave, barrel (pictured) and cyclinder version available and they'll set you back £55 a hit. Pair with an energy-saving bulb for maximum greeness and minimal bills. G|O|E Design
